We kindly invite you to participate in the lecture-discussion “Law-Making Process in Bicameral Parliaments: a Comparative Perspective”, which will be held by Basile Ridard, Public Law Professor at Poitiers University.

Researcher will present the main advantages/disadvantages of bicameral systems as well will provide concrete examples about Law-Making in France, Germany, UK and Spain. Here will be a discussion with participants to compare the process in these parliaments with the Law-Making Process in the Seimas.
